MicroStation CONNECT Edition Hilfe

Reguläre Ausdrücke

Reguläre Ausdrücke sind Sonderzeichenkombinationen, die Ihnen helfen, verschiedene Operationen durchzuführen, wie Durchsuchen nach variablen Formen des Textes und Auswählen mehrerer Objekte, wenn Sie den Namen einer Zelle, der Referenz oder der Ebene angeben.

Reguläre Ausdrücke, die allen Operationen gemeinsam sind, sind unten aufgeführt:

Zeichen Bedeutung
^ Anfang einer Linie oder eines Ausdrucks. Wenn dieses Zeichen am Beginn eines Ausdrucks steht, muss eine Zeile mit dem Muster beginnen, das auf das Zeichen folgt. Wenn es als erstes Zeichen einer Zeichenklasse verwendet wird, setzt es die Definition außer Kraft.
$ Ende einer Zeile oder eines Ausdrucks. Wenn dieses Zeichen am Ende eines Ausdrucks steht, muss eine Zeile mit dem Muster enden, das dem Zeichen vorangestellt ist.
. Jedes beliebige Zeichen.
[:alpha:] Ein Zeichen des ASCII-Alphabets (entspricht der Zeichenklasse [a-z bzw. A-Z]).
\ d Eine Ziffer des ASCII-Alphabets (entspricht der Zeichenklasse [0-9]).
[:alnum:] Eine Ziffer oder ein Zeichen des ASCII-Alphabets (entspricht der Zeichenklasse [a-z, A-Z oder 0-9]).

Ein Doppelpunkt nach einem Leerzeichen entspricht einem beliebigen Satzzeichen.

Nachfolgend erhalten Sie eine Liste der regulären Ausdrücke, die lediglich zum Suchen von Text verwendet werden.

Zeichen Bedeutung
[ ] Zeichen in diesen Klammern beschreiben eine Zeichenklasse oder eine benutzerdefinierte Wildcard.
* Das vorangestellte Zeichen (oder die vorangestellte Zeichenklasse) darf nur einmal vorkommen.
+ Das vorangestellte Zeichen (oder die vorangestellte Zeichenklasse) muss sich mindestens einmal wiederholen.
- Wenn dieses Zeichen innerhalb einer Zeichenklasse verwendet wird, stellt es einen Zeichenbereich dar.

Nachfolgend erhalten Sie eine Liste der regulären Ausdrücke, die lediglich zum Suchen von mehreren Elementen verwendet werden.

Zeichen Bedeutung
c Jeder Buchstabe c ohne Sonderbedeutung stimmt mit sich selbst überein.
\c Deaktivieren Sie die Sonderbedeutung des Buchstabens c.
[…] Alle Zeichen in …; Bereichen wie z.B. a-z sind gültig.
[^…] Alle Einzelzeichen außerhalb von …; Bereichen sind gültig.
s* Kein oder mehrere Vorkommen der Zeichenfolge s (das vorhergehende Zeichen).
s+ Ein oder mehrere Vorkommen der Zeichenfolge s (das vorhergehende Zeichen.
st Zeichenfolge s gefolgt von Zeichenfolge t.